Medford hosting public hearing on grant funding

The public comment period for the City of Medford’s proposed Community Development Block Grants (CDBG) ends Thursday, May 2nd. On May 2nd, the city is having a public hearing at the Medford City Hall at 6 p.m. to hear feedback.
